What makes an adjustable bed such a worthwhile investment? Many people have already found that they’re able to get a better night’s sleep while sleeping on an adjustable bed instead of a flat bed, and it’s actually a very simple explanation: flat beds just cannot provide the support that your body needs to stay comfortable at night.

Because the human body naturally has curves (the spine itself is actually curved in an “s” shape), it’s difficult to find a comfortable sleep position when lying on a flat bed. A flat mattress creates empty space when the body contours, specifically at the neck, lower back, and knee areas. Without support, these contours require muscles to keep steady at night while the individual is sleeping, which often results in muscle tension, aches, and pains after hours of being strained.

With adjustable beds, every contour is supported with the proper mattress position because the mattress itself is flexible enough to be adjusted to a customized position. This allows the person to find comfort while sleeping and it minimizes the number of times which the individual is likely to wake up because of an uncomfortable position.
